在开发 iOS 应用程序时,需要创建和发布证书来验证开发者的身份,以确保应用程序的安全性和可靠性。本文将介绍如何在 iOS 开发中创建和发布证书。
一、证书的类型
在 iOS 开发中,主要有三种类型的证书:开发证书、发布证书和推送证书。其中,开发证书用于开发和测试应用程序,发布证书用于发布应用程序,推送证书用于向设备发送推送通知。
二、创建开发证书
1. 登录苹果开发者网站,进入“Certificates, Identifiers & Profiles”页面。
2. 在“Certificates”选项卡中,点击“+”按钮,选择“iOS App Development”证书类型。
3. 在创建证书页面中,选择“iOS App Development”证书类型,并输入证书名称。
4. 在下一步中,选择需要使用该证书的开发者,并将证书下载到本地。
5. 双击下载的证书文件,将其添加到钥匙串中。
6. 在 Xcode 中,选择“Preferences”菜单,进入“Accounts”选项卡,添加 Apple ID 并登录。
7. 在 Xcode 中,进入项目设置,选择“General”选项卡,选择正确的团队,并选择正确的证书。
三、创建发布证书
1. 在“Certificates”选项卡中,点击“+”按钮,选择“App Store and Ad Hoc”证书类型。
2. 在创建证书页面中,选择“App Store and Ad Hoc”证书类型,并输入证书名称。
3. 在下一步中,选择需要使用该证书的开发者,并将证书下载到本地。
4. 双击下载的证书文件,将其添加到钥匙串中。
5. 在 Xcode 中,选择“Preferences”菜单,进入“Accounts”选项卡,添加 Apple ID 并登录。
6. 在 Xcode 中,进入项目设置,选择“General”选项卡,选择正确的团队,并选择正确的证书。
7. 在 Xcode 中,选择“Product”菜单,进入“Archive”选项卡,将应用程序打包并上传到 App Store。
四、结语
以上就是 iOS 开发中创建和发布证书的详细介绍。通过创建和发布证书,开发者可以确保应用程序的安全性和可靠性,并顺利将应用程序上传到 App Store。